玩什么游戏适合编程
-
玩什么游戏适合编程?
编程是一个需要专注、思考和解决问题的过程。选择适合编程的游戏可以帮助开发者锻炼专注力、逻辑思维和问题解决能力。以下是一些适合编程的游戏推荐:
1.《Minecraft》:这款沙盒游戏提供了一个自由的世界,玩家可以通过建造、挖掘等方式自由发挥。玩家还可以使用命令方块来编写简单的指令,创建自动化的机器和逻辑门等。这款游戏可以帮助玩家熟悉逻辑思维和基本的编程概念。
2.《Human Resource Machine》:这款游戏模拟了一个办公室环境,玩家扮演雇员完成办公室任务。玩家需要通过编写简单的指令来操作人物完成任务,如移动、复制、加减等。游戏逐渐引入更复杂的任务和指令,帮助玩家锻炼逻辑思维和解决问题的能力。
3.《Screeps》:这是一个基于JavaScript编程的在线多人游戏。玩家需要编写代码来控制自己的虚拟生物群体,完成资源采集、建筑构建和敌对行动等任务。这款游戏可以帮助玩家深入学习编程语言,并锻炼编程逻辑和算法设计能力。
4.《CodeCombat》:这是一个以角色扮演为主题的编程游戏。玩家需要通过编写代码来控制角色完成关卡中的任务,如战斗、收集物品等。游戏提供了多种编程语言选择,包括Python、JavaScript等,适合不同程度的玩家学习和实践编程。
5.《TIS-100》:这是一个模拟计算机的解谜游戏。玩家需要通过编写简单的指令来操作虚拟计算机的处理器和内存,完成一系列的编程任务。游戏模拟了低级别的汇编语言,适合有一定编程基础的玩家挑战和学习。
选择适合编程的游戏不仅可以提高编程技巧,还可以帮助玩家培养解决问题的能力和创造力。通过游戏的方式学习编程,可以让学习变得更加有趣和互动。因此,如果你想在编程过程中增加乐趣和挑战,不妨尝试以上推荐的游戏。
1年前 -
编程是一项需要专注和创造力的技能,但长时间沉浸在编码中可能会导致注意力不集中和疲劳。因此,玩一些有趣的游戏可以帮助缓解压力并提高编程技能。以下是几个适合编程者玩的游戏:
1.《Minecraft》:Minecraft是一款开放世界的沙盒游戏,玩家可以自由构建和修改游戏世界。通过使用Minecraft的Mod(游戏模组),玩家可以学习并实践编程技巧,例如创建自己的游戏物品、修改游戏规则等。
2.《Kerbal Space Program》:Kerbal Space Program是一款太空探索模拟游戏。玩家可以扮演宇航员,建立自己的太空船、探索星球并进行科学研究。该游戏提供了编程接口和插件,玩家可以学习和使用基本的编程概念来自动化任务和控制航天器。
3.《Human Resource Machine》:Human Resource Machine是一款编程题解谜类游戏。玩家需要通过编写简单的指令来解决各个关卡的难题。该游戏可以帮助玩家学习算法和编程逻辑,锻炼解决问题和优化代码的能力。
4.《TIS-100》:TIS-100是一款低级别的编程游戏,玩家需要通过编写和调试汇编代码来解决游戏中的各种难题。这款游戏对于学习底层编程概念和理解计算机结构非常有帮助。
5.《Factorio》:Factorio是一款沙盒策略游戏,玩家需要建立和管理自动化工厂。在游戏中,玩家可以通过编写脚本和使用机器人自动化生产和制造过程。这款游戏可以帮助玩家学习和练习逻辑思维和计算机控制技巧。
以上游戏中的编程元素可以帮助玩家锻炼解决问题的能力、培养逻辑思维,并提供一种有趣而实践性的方式来应用编程技能。无论是初学者还是有经验的编程者,都可以从这些游戏中找到乐趣和学习机会。
1年前 -
玩游戏可以是一种有趣的方式来学习编程。编程游戏不仅能够提供娱乐,还可以帮助玩家锻炼逻辑思维、问题解决能力和编程技巧。下面是几款适合编程的游戏,它们可以帮助初学者入门,同时也能挑战有一定编程基础的玩家。
1.《编程正确》:这是一款面向初学者的编程游戏,通过逐步引导操作的方式,教授玩家编程的基础知识和逻辑思维。游戏的目标是通过编写程序来解决各种问题,例如在迷宫中找到出口、控制机器人完成任务等。
2.《闯关学Python》:这是一款专门教授Python编程的游戏,它将编程的概念和语法以游戏的形式呈现出来。玩家需要通过完成各种任务来学习Python的基本语法和常用函数,同时还包括了一些高级的编程概念。
3.《编程囤货》:这是一款编程和经营类的游戏,玩家需要扮演公司的CTO,负责编写代码、管理团队和运营公司。通过完成任务和挑战,玩家可以学习到软件开发过程中的各个环节和技巧,同时也可以锻炼自己的管理能力。
4.《机器人工程师》:这是一款模拟机器人编程的游戏,玩家需要设计和编写代码来控制机器人完成各种任务,例如拾取物品、解决难题等。游戏提供了多种编程语言和机器人模型,可以让玩家灵活选择。
5.《头脑风暴》:这是一款解谜类的编程游戏,玩家需要利用指定的编程语言和工具来解决各种难题。游戏提供了多个难度等级和题目类型,适合不同水平的玩家挑战。
总的来说,选择适合自己的编程游戏是一种很好的学习编程的方式。通过不断的练习和挑战,你可以提升自己的编程技巧和解决问题的能力。尝试不同的游戏,并找到自己感兴趣的领域,从而更好地学习编程。
1年前